黑狐家游戏

文件系统和数据库系统的区别和联系,文件系统和数据库系统的区别和联系,文件系统与数据库系统,深层解析其差异与内在联系

欧气 1 0
文件系统与数据库系统虽同属数据管理范畴,但存在本质区别。文件系统以文件为单位存储数据,注重文件组织和访问效率;数据库系统则以数据库为单位,强调数据完整性、一致性及多用户访问控制。两者联系在于都用于存储、检索和管理数据,但数据库系统在数据管理和安全性方面更为先进。

本文目录导读:

  1. 文件系统与数据库系统的区别
  2. 文件系统与数据库系统的联系

随着信息技术的发展,文件系统和数据库系统已成为现代企业信息管理的重要工具,虽然两者都用于存储、管理和检索数据,但它们在技术架构、功能特点、应用场景等方面存在显著差异,本文将深入剖析文件系统和数据库系统的区别与联系,以期为读者提供更全面的认识。

文件系统与数据库系统的区别

1、数据结构

文件系统以文件为单位存储数据,数据结构相对简单,通常采用顺序存储、链式存储或索引存储等方式,而数据库系统以表为单位存储数据,采用复杂的数据模型,如关系模型、层次模型、网状模型等。

文件系统和数据库系统的区别和联系,文件系统和数据库系统的区别和联系,文件系统与数据库系统,深层解析其差异与内在联系

图片来源于网络,如有侵权联系删除

2、数据完整性

文件系统对数据完整性保障较弱,容易发生数据冗余、不一致等问题,数据库系统通过定义数据约束、触发器等机制,确保数据的一致性和完整性。

3、数据安全性

文件系统安全性较低,易受病毒、恶意软件等攻击,数据库系统采用用户权限、角色控制、审计等安全机制,保障数据安全。

4、数据一致性

文件系统难以保证数据一致性,尤其在多用户环境下,数据库系统通过事务管理、锁机制等确保数据一致性。

5、扩展性

文件系统扩展性较差,当数据量增大时,系统性能会受到影响,数据库系统具有较好的扩展性,可通过增加硬件资源、优化配置等方式提高性能。

文件系统和数据库系统的区别和联系,文件系统和数据库系统的区别和联系,文件系统与数据库系统,深层解析其差异与内在联系

图片来源于网络,如有侵权联系删除

6、管理复杂度

文件系统管理相对简单,但容易造成数据冗余、不一致等问题,数据库系统管理复杂,需要数据库管理员进行维护、优化等操作。

文件系统与数据库系统的联系

1、数据存储

文件系统和数据库系统都用于存储数据,提供数据持久化功能,文件系统适合存储结构化数据,而数据库系统适合存储复杂、关联性强的数据。

2、数据检索

文件系统和数据库系统都支持数据检索功能,用户可以根据条件快速查询所需数据。

3、数据备份与恢复

文件系统和数据库系统都具备数据备份与恢复功能,以防止数据丢失或损坏。

文件系统和数据库系统的区别和联系,文件系统和数据库系统的区别和联系,文件系统与数据库系统,深层解析其差异与内在联系

图片来源于网络,如有侵权联系删除

4、数据共享

文件系统和数据库系统都支持数据共享,多用户可同时访问和操作数据。

5、系统集成

文件系统和数据库系统可相互集成,实现数据交换和共享,将文件系统中的数据导入数据库系统进行管理。

文件系统和数据库系统在数据结构、数据完整性、数据安全性、数据一致性、扩展性、管理复杂度等方面存在显著差异,两者也存在紧密的联系,共同服务于数据存储、管理和检索,了解文件系统和数据库系统的区别与联系,有助于我们更好地选择和使用这些工具,提高信息管理的效率和质量。

标签: #文件系统特性 #数据库系统功能 #数据管理差异

黑狐家游戏
  • 评论列表

留言评论